The Variety of Clays and Their Unique Benefits
Speaking of types, you might be wondering—what kind of clay should you pick? Here’s a little rundown that’ll make it easier to choose:
1. Bentonite Clay
Bentonite clay, also called Montmorillonite, is superb at absorbing impurities and toxins. It swells up when mixed with liquid, which allows it to draw out the “gunk” (yes, that’s a technical term) from deep within your pores. Ideal for those oily skin days.
2. Kaolin Clay
This one is the gentle giant. Coming in shades like white, yellow, and red, it works effortlessly for those with sensitive skin. Kaolin clay won’t strip your skin—it’s perfect for a more mild cleanse.

3. Fuller’s Earth
Known for its brightening abilities, Fuller’s Earth can help you deal with hyperpigmentation or just to give your skin that enviable glow. It’s like a lightbulb for your face, but made of earth.
4. French Green Clay
A personal favorite for its detoxifying gusto. Rich in magnesium, calcium, potassium, and other good stuff, it’s best suited for oily or combination skin types. When your face needs a fresh start, go green.

Step-by-Step Guide to Using a Clay Mask
Let’s talk application. Here’s the deal. It’s not rocket science—but a bit of technique can help amplify the experience.
- Start Fresh: Cleanse your face thoroughly before diving in. This will ensure your skin is ready to soak up all the goodness your mask has to offer.
- Setting the Scene: Mix some powdered clay with water (or a toner for an extra kick), and stir until you achieve a yogurt-like consistency.
- Smooth It On: Using your fingertips or a spatula, apply a medium layer on your face. Avoid the eyes unless you’re into that “clay mascara” look.
- Chill Out: Here’s where you get to let everything sink in. No need to let the mask turn bone-dry—that’ll only rob your skin of its natural moisture. Aim for slightly tacky.
- 5. **Rinse Roulette: Use lukewarm water for cleanup, pat instead of rub, and follow up with a moisturizer. It’s like closing the book on an utterly satisfying chapter.
Troubleshooting: Common Missteps To Avoid!

No cheats here; uncovering the benefits comes with avoiding some traps.
- Overuse Woes: Calculated frequency is key. Stick to 1-2 times a week unless you’re dealing with very oily skin.
- Tug Too Far: Resist leaving it until it flakes right off. That’s a no-no—it only dries out your skin and ruins the intended effect.
- The Tight Squeeze: Tighter isn’t better—texture should relax…well, like you ideally should too.
Ready-to-Use Natural Skin Care Products
While playing kitchen alchemist can get your creative juices flowing, I totally get it—not everyone has time for that. That’s where ready-to-use natural skin care products come in.
If you prefer something pre-made, you can seek out products boasting all-natural ingredients without unnecessary chemicals. Look for labels that have that balanced blend of clays and hydrating agents, versus a mystique of unpronounceables.
When shopping for clay masks, consider your skin type. Is dryness dogging you? Seek ones that include shea butter or aloe vera. Struggling with oiliness? Hunt for formulas high in Bentonite or French Green Clay.
